Probably the software used to create the design was not the same software you opened the design with. Different software products interpret the colors differently. Change them to the colors needed. You didn't do anything wrong, it's a software issue.

I usually copy and paste the color chart or digitizers chosen colors into notepad. I don't see the colors but it states the thread (Maderia Rayon) and the number. I have a book and color charts that I can use as a reference. This is just in case I can't eyeball the design and figure out the color myself. I also save a copy of the picture of the design to use as reference.
